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Package dotty before running partest. | Dmitry Petrashko | 2015-05-28 | 1 | -6/+6 |
| | | | | To make sure that artifact is the same. | ||||
* | Added partest-only sbt target and less verbose file generation | vsalvis | 2015-05-22 | 1 | -1/+2 |
| | |||||
* | Partest command line options (same as scala) useable from sbt | vsalvis | 2015-05-13 | 1 | -3/+7 |
| | |||||
* | Removing pickle tests because directory doesn't exist anymore. | vsalvis | 2015-05-12 | 1 | -2/+2 |
| | |||||
* | More robust partest/test switching for concurrent sbt instances | vsalvis | 2015-05-12 | 1 | -43/+38 |
| | |||||
* | Better documentation for partest dottyJar option | vsalvis | 2015-05-12 | 1 | -3/+13 |
| | |||||
* | Run tests for partest | vsalvis | 2015-05-12 | 1 | -11/+33 |
| | |||||
* | Merge pull request #535 from dotty-staging/Build-scala | Dmitry Petrashko | 2015-05-09 | 1 | -0/+7 |
|\ | | | | | dotc: Get versions of all dependencies from Build.scala | ||||
| * | Get rid of build.sbt. | Dmitry Petrashko | 2015-05-04 | 1 | -0/+7 |
| | | |||||
* | | Update scala-compiler fork. | Dmitry Petrashko | 2015-05-08 | 1 | -1/+1 |
|/ | | | | Includes fixes to lambas, and no type projections in signatures. | ||||
* | Leave traces for future profiling. | Dmitry Petrashko | 2015-04-30 | 1 | -1/+5 |
| | |||||
* | Increase heap and stack size on travis. | Dmitry Petrashko | 2015-04-30 | 1 | -1/+1 |
| | |||||
* | Robuster FileLock test to prevent exception if fork in Test is ever disabled | vsalvis | 2015-04-20 | 1 | -1/+2 |
| | |||||
* | Using FileLock to distinguish between test and partest mode | vsalvis | 2015-04-20 | 1 | -7/+11 |
| | |||||
* | Partest for Dotty with pos tests and neg tests with error count | vsalvis | 2015-04-17 | 1 | -4/+16 |
| | |||||
* | Update version of scalac-compiler fork. | Dmitry Petrashko | 2015-04-16 | 1 | -1/+1 |
| | | | | | | | This update allows to have non-static lambdas. It doesn't mean that we should emit such, as they are potential memory leak. See #480 Fixes #470 | ||||
* | Ensure spaces after `if` in Dotty source. | Dmitry Petrashko | 2015-04-09 | 1 | -1/+1 |
| | |||||
* | Add spaces around + in dotty source. | Dmitry Petrashko | 2015-04-09 | 1 | -2/+2 |
| | |||||
* | Remove trailing spaces in Dotty source. | Dmitry Petrashko | 2015-04-09 | 1 | -2/+2 |
| | |||||
* | Add scalastyle to dependencies, with default config. | Dmitry Petrashko | 2015-04-09 | 1 | -0/+3 |
| | |||||
* | Update version of scalac fork. | Dmitry Petrashko | 2015-04-02 | 1 | -1/+1 |
| | |||||
* | Update version of scalac fork. | Dmitry Petrashko | 2015-03-11 | 1 | -1/+1 |
| | | | | | Includes fixed for emitting string concatenation if string originates from an array. Eg `"hello " + Array("world")(0)` | ||||
* | Add dotty repl & type stealer | Dmitry Petrashko | 2015-02-17 | 1 | -1/+2 |
| | | | | | | | | | | Dotty requires a mangled bootclasspath to start. It means that `console` mode of sbt doesn't work for us. At least I wasn't able to make sbt fork in console, so instead I've added a Scala-repl into dotty itself :-) It would be good to make it use dotty one day when we have a backend :-) | ||||
* | Update version of scalac fork | Dmitry Petrashko | 2014-12-16 | 1 | -1/+1 |
| | |||||
* | Update to newer version of scalac fork | Dmitry Petrashko | 2014-12-16 | 1 | -1/+1 |
| | |||||
* | Depend on custom compiler with https://github.com/scala/scala/pull/4136 ↵ | Dmitry Petrashko | 2014-12-16 | 1 | -2/+3 |
| | | | | incorporated | ||||
* | Add option to optimize the JVM for short-runnning applications | Guillaume Martres | 2014-11-17 | 1 | -1/+8 |
| | | | | | | | | | | Ideally, dotc should reuse a resident compiler and we should not fork sbt for every task. Until this happens, this option is useful for development. Fixes #222. Usage: $ sbt -DOshort="" $ ./bin/dotc -Oshort foo.scala | ||||
* | Patmat now succeeds tests. | Dmitry Petrashko | 2014-09-23 | 1 | -1/+1 |
| | | | | @odersky there are some tests disabled, which failed due to other phases being able to transform more code. | ||||
* | @odersky have a look. | Dmitry Petrashko | 2014-09-23 | 1 | -1/+1 |
| | | | | testOnly dotc.tests | ||||
* | Renamed parameters in Typer&Applictaions. | Dmitry Petrashko | 2014-09-23 | 1 | -1/+1 |
| | | | | Indicating that pt is type of selector is this pattern match makes it easier to follow. | ||||
* | Allow converting junit test to scalameter benchmark | Dmitry Petrashko | 2014-09-17 | 1 | -2/+48 |
| | | | | | | Lets start tracking performance! To run benchmarks execute `dotty-bench/test:run` in sbt | ||||
* | Enable improved incremental compilation (name hashing) | Grzegorz Kossakowski | 2014-07-25 | 1 | -0/+3 |
| | | | | | The algorithm is stable enough to try it out for dotty build. It's enabled in sbt and Akka already. | ||||
* | Use the final scala 2.11. | George Leontiev | 2014-06-23 | 1 | -1/+1 |
| | |||||
* | Merge pull request #119 from DarkDimius/leaks | Dmitry Petrashko | 2014-05-06 | 1 | -3/+7 |
|\ | | | | | Context escape detection. | ||||
| * | Enable javac lint deprecation&unchecked warnings. | Dmitry Petrashko | 2014-04-09 | 1 | -0/+2 |
| | | |||||
| * | Context escape detection. | Dmitry Petrashko | 2014-04-09 | 1 | -3/+5 |
| | | | | | | | | | | | | | | During creation of each of DottyTests context is stolen from test and a WeakReference for it is created. After running all tests references are examined to detect if any of them has leaked. | ||||
* | | Sbt: simplify debugging and tracing | Dmitry Petrashko | 2014-04-11 | 1 | -3/+9 |
|/ | |||||
* | Update to Scala 2.11.0-RC3. | Nada Amin | 2014-03-25 | 1 | -1/+1 |
| | | | | This was needed for running dotc.Main using latest Scala IDE 2.11 release. | ||||
* | Enable verbose printing of exceptions thrown in junit tests | Dmitry Petrashko | 2014-03-02 | 1 | -0/+2 |
| | |||||
* | Add Scalac scanning to the Travis CI build | Vlad Ureche | 2014-02-16 | 1 | -1/+10 |
| | | | | | And silence some of the error messages we print so the build log doesn't go above 4MB (Travis' limit) | ||||
* | Nitpicking | Vlad Ureche | 2014-01-23 | 1 | -10/+10 |
| | |||||
* | Fix (run, Test) classpath issues | Vlad Ureche | 2014-01-23 | 1 | -4/+18 |
| | |||||
* | Build infrastructure | Vlad Ureche | 2014-01-23 | 3 | -1/+43 |
| | |||||
* | Add SBT build, .gitignore. | Jason Zaugg | 2013-02-10 | 2 | -0/+4 |